Transaction 378e42db22b2ce28c3afb123c31722435c2837cceaa83b6e05a495cd2ef7b98e
1 Input
1 Output
-
378e42db22b2ce28c3afb123c31722435c2837cceaa83b6e05a495cd2ef7b98e:0
- value
- 11946249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66e45fb80804f39d42793fd4b93f495ec4674903 OP_EQUAL
- address
- 3B54Ron8eHbjpDh9x7PwCbD9bUvwUAbkXr